FIGURES RELEASED BY DARATECH INC. SHOW RECORD MARKET POSITION FOR AVEVA

Excellent sales record as well as Tribon acquisition catapults AVEVA towards top of industry

January 24, 2005 – DaratechPLANT2005 -- Houston Texas -- Annual analysis of the process and power and marine IT solutions markets released by Daratech Inc. of Cambridge, Massachusetts, a leading market research firm, have shown record growth for AVEVA <LSE:AVV> in the calendar year 2004. The figures, released annually to coincide with the DaratechPLANT conference, showed annualised non-GAAP figures for Overall Plant and Non-Process and Power Shipbuilding 2004 of about US$118 million (£60 million) for software and services - highlighting the industry's most dramatic growth of the year.

"It's a combination of successes," explained Richard Longdon, CEO, AVEVA Group plc. "Obviously, the acquisition of Tribon Solutions has had an effect, but it's important to put it into perspective. In revenue terms, the non-plant related marine sector is significantly smaller than power, oil and gas, and it has only contributed for half of the year. This has been an historical year for AVEVA and it's a huge commendation for our staff, our vision and our technology."

"AVEVA has secured some high-value, high-profile contracts this year," Richard continued. "The project to build Europe's first major nuclear facility in ten years chose our VANTAGE suite for the entire power facility but all over the world, in very large contracts, we have been set against the stiffest competition and have come out on top. Our performance is an unequivocal statement of faith in the long-term value that AVEVA offers."

AVEVA has capitalised upon ongoing industrial growth in the Far East, earning commendations from DAEWOO, a stronghold in the expanding power sector and the late signing of a development and license agreement with Hyundai Heavy Industries, the world's biggest producer of ships. In October, The Group announced a major solutions contract with Woodside Energy Limited, the operator of Australia's largest energy resource development project as well as ongoing success with the Data Warehouse Portal for the US$4.3 million CSPC Nanhai Project.

Charles Foundyller CEO, Daratech Inc. commented: "AVEVA's significant growth in 2004 reflects their dedication to their strategy and the industry’s faith in their ability to continue to deliver strong, innovative solutions. While their core software proposition has evolved with stability and pace, their record of making alliances with or acquiring solutions in areas adjacent to their expertise has clearly paid dividends. A company that was known in the 1980s for 3D design has become the provider of a comprehensive suite of integrated solutions."

Projected figures for 2005 show continued growth as revenue from ongoing contracts is realised. The Group is also expected to announce further developments from its partnership with Autodesk, the world's leading 3D digital software company.

"AVEVA's success is evidence of its responsiveness to process, power and marine companies who want to streamline the design process," said Mark Strassman, senior director of marketing for Autodesk's Platform Technology Division. "By partnering to integrate AVEVA's industry-leading software with AutoCAD, the world's leading CAD software, we offer a best-of-breed solution to help make plant and piping design more productive and cost-effective."


About AVEVA Group plc

AVEVA Group plc (http://www.aveva.com) is one of the world’s foremost and fastest-growing lifecycle engineering IT solutions and services providers to the oil and gas, paper and pulp, power, chemical, pharmaceutical and shipbuilding industries. Listed on the London Stock Exchange (LSE:AVV), the Group reported pre-tax profits for the year ended March 2004 of GBP 6.1 million on a turnover of GBP 38 million, a growth in turnover of 113% in five years.

The Group has a history of groundbreaking innovation that spans five decades. Serving over 1100 clients, AVEVA has a dominant position in many market sectors both on and offshore. In May 2004, the Group acquired Tribon Solutions AB, the market-leading shipbuilding solution company and now serves 80% of the world's top 20 shipbuilders.

The Group's clients include leading plant Owner Operators and engineering contractors such as 3M, ALSTOM Power, AMEC, BASF, Daewoo Heavy Industries, Daewoo Shipbuilding & Marine Engineering (DSME), Dalian New Shipbuilding, Du Pont, Electricité de France, Halliburton, Hanjin Heavy Industries, Hitachi, Hudong Zhonghua Shipyard, Hyundai Mipo Dockyard, Hyundai Samho Heavy Industries, Kawasaki Heavy Industries, Kawasaki Shipbuilding Corporation, Krupp Uhde, Kvaerner, Merck, Mitsubishi Heavy Industries, Mitsui Engineering & Shipbuilding, Petronas Carigali, Samsung Engineering, Shanghai Waigaoqiao Shipbuilding, Shell and STX Shipbuilding.

Headquartered in Cambridge, England, AVEVA Group plc and its operating subsidiaries currently employ more than 450 staff worldwide with offices in England, Australia, China, France, Germany, Hong Kong, India, Italy, Japan, KSA, Malaysia, Norway, Russia, Singapore, Sweden, South Korea and the USA.
